LINUX.ORG.RU

ядра 2.4.x и дискеты msdos


0

0

после установки любого из ядер 2.4.x (сейчас у меня 2.4.3) mount перестает монтировать дискеты msdos. mtools тоже перестают работать. с ядрами 2.2.x таких проблем нет. где грабли, кто знает?

anonymous
Ответ на: комментарий от anonymous

угу по-разному пробовал и в виде модуля поддержку fat компилял, и в ядро встраивал - ничего не помогает. Не понятно, почему mtools не работают, они же от поддержки fat в ядре не зависят как я понимаю.

anonymous
()

Хорошо, a mount что пишет когда пытается монтировать или он у тебя
немой :)) ? В любом случае попытайся примонтировать указывая
файловую систему в командной строке, не полагаясь на fstab
# mount -t vfat /dev/fd0 /mnt/floppy

justas
()
Ответ на: комментарий от justas

Суем досовскую дискетку, заведомо рабочую, в дисковод:

# mount -t vfat /dev/fd0 /mnt/floppy
mount: wrong fs type, bad option, bad superblock on /dev/fd0
or too many mounted filesystems

Запускаю mdir из пакета mtools

# mdir
init A: non DOS media
Cannot initialize 'A:'

Вот такая вот фигня :-(

anonymous
()

Трям, м-да ! А ты уверен, что у тебя дисковод рабочий и шлейфы не перепутаны? Это я к чему, у меня 2.4.2 к флопповоду неприязни не имеет абсолютно. Поэтому попробуй проверить работу флоппика с ядром 2.2.х и если работает, то попробуй обновить версию mount. А вобще причин может быть море. Проверь все еще раз досконально.

justas
()
Ответ на: комментарий от justas

В том и дело, что с ядром, например, 2.2.16 все работает как часы.. mount обновлял, не помогло. думаю не в mount дело, так как все остальные девайсы (cdrom и др.) монтируюся без проблем. к тому же mtools работают с дисководом напрямую и не зависят ни от поддержки fat в ядре, ни от mount...

anonymous
()

Та-а-а-к. Идея следующая. Поддержка floppy в ядре. Вопрос глупый,
но все же что поэтому поводу пишет dmesg?

justas
()

Ну что же, где это вы пропали? Мне самому уже стало интересно. Если все заработало, расскажите хоть в чем дело было

justas
()
Ответ на: комментарий от justas

Замотался совсем :-( Ничего так и не завелось, а в dmesg про флопарь только две строчки: Floppy drive(s): fd0 is 1.44M FDC 0 is a post-1991 82077

anonymous
()

Я подумаю. Напишите мне на patskalyov@aprold.usue.ru, авось вытянем.

justas
()
22 марта 2002 г.

У меня та же проблема. dmesg говорит, что 0х03f0 is already in use ... Kernel rebuilding helped once but lost My soundcard module...

So - REBUILDING-KERNELL-WILL-HELP- someday! klux

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.